KIITEE 2026 Qualifying Marks and Eligibility
KIITEE 2026 does not set a fixed minimum score to "pass" the entrance test. Every candidate who appears gets a rank. That rank — and seat availability in your preferred branch — determines whether you get admission, not a pass/fail score in the entrance exam itself. However, you must meet the academic eligibility requirements from your Class 12 board exams. Even with a good KIITEE rank, you cannot get a seat if your board marks fall short.
| Category | Minimum Marks Required in Class 12 PCM |
|---|---|
| General / OBC / EWS | Minimum 60% aggregate in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ics |
| SC / ST | Minimum 55% aggregate in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ics |
| B.Arch (all categories) | Minimum 50% aggregate in Class 12; Mathematics compulsory; valid NATA or JEE Paper 2 score also required |
These percentage criteria apply to your Class 12 board exam result — not to the KIITEE entrance test.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ics must have been compulsory subjects in your Class 12 curriculum. If your board results are still awaited, you are provisionally eligible — but you must produce the final marksheet showing the required percentage before completing your admission formalities at KIIT. If you miss this threshold by even a small margin, your KIITEE rank cannot help you secure a seat.
KIITEE 2026 Cutoff
The KIITEE cutoff is the closing rank at which the last available seat in a particular branch gets filled during counselling. KIIT University does not always release a separate official cutoff document — the closing rank from each counselling round effectively acts as the cutoff. The KIITEE 2026 final cutoff will only be known after all counselling rounds conclude, expected in August 2026.
The table below shows approximate closing ranks for major B.Tech branches at KIIT University, Bhubaneswar, based on 2024 and 2025 counselling data. Use these as a reference to gauge your chances when planning your choices. CSE remains the most sought-after branch, with closing ranks tightening each year.
| B.Tech Branch | Approx. Closing Rank 2025 | Approx. Closing Rank 2024 |
|---|---|---|
| Computer Science and Engineering (CSE) | ~5,800 | ~6,100 |
| Electronics and Communication Engineering (ECE) | ~10,000 | ~11,000 |
| Electrical Engineering / EEE | ~14,000 | ~16,000 |
| Mechanical Engineering | ~18,000 | ~20,000 |
| Civil Engineering | ~22,000 | ~25,000 |
| Biotechnology | ~20,000 | ~22,000 |
Note: All figures above are approximate and based on available third-party data from previous years. Actual KIITEE 2026 closing ranks will depend on the total number of candidates, available seats, and demand during counselling. Verify the final cutoff on kiitee.kiit.ac.in once 2026 counselling concludes.
Category-wise cutoffs are generally more relaxed. SC and ST candidates benefit from reserved seats and lower academic eligibility requirements. For these categories, the effective closing rank for CSE may be higher (a weaker overall rank can still earn you a seat) compared to the general category pool. Check the official KIITEE 2026 counselling documents for the precise category-wise closing rank data once they are published.

What After KIITEE Result 2026?
Once you have your KIITEE rank card, the admission process moves through choice-filling, seat allotment, document verification, and physical reporting. KIIT University manages all of this online through the official KIITEE portal. Here is a step-by-step breakdown of what comes next.
Step 1 — Choice Filling: Log in to the KIITEE portal and fill in your preferred B.Tech branches in order of priority. You can list multiple choices. The system processes your choices against your rank and available seats. Higher-priority choices are considered first, so put your most desired branch at the top.
Step 2 — Seat Allotment: KIIT University releases seat allotment results in rounds. If you get your preferred branch in Round 1, accept the seat and pay the admission fee within the deadline shown on the portal. Missing this deadline means your seat is released to the next candidate. If you do not get your top choice in Round 1, wait for subsequent rounds — seats that go unfilled are re-offered each time.
Step 3 — Document Verification: After you accept a seat, you must verify your documents — either online or in person as directed by KIIT University. Keep these originals and self-attested photocopies ready:
- KIITEE 2026 rank card (downloaded from the portal)
- Class 10 and Class 12 mark sheets and passing certificates
- Transfer Certificate from your previous school or college
- Valid government-issued photo ID (Aadhaar card, passport, or similar)
- Recent passport-size photographs
- Category certificate for SC / ST / OBC / EWS / PwD (if applicable)
- Migration certificate if you studied outside Odisha
Step 4 — Reporting: On the date specified by KIIT University, report to the allotted campus with all original documents. Complete enrolment formalities, submit photographs, and complete any remaining fee payment to confirm your seat permanently as a new KIIT student.

Ques. How is KIITEE 2026 rank calculated?
Ans. Your KIITEE 2026 rank is based on your total score in the entrance exam. Correct answers add marks; wrong answers attract negative marking. Total scores of all candidates across all test slots in the same phase are ranked in descending order (highest scorer gets rank 1). In case of a tie, KIIT University applies a tiebreaker — usually based on marks in a specific subject or the candidate’s age. Your rank is then used during counselling to determine seat eligibility.
